首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[函数]sodium_crypto_core_ristretto255_scalar_sub()函数—用法及示例

发布于 2025-05-05 20:05:50
0
23

函数名称:sodium_crypto_core_ristretto255_scalar_sub()

函数描述:该函数用于计算两个Ristretto255标量的差值。

适用版本:PHP 7.2.0及以上版本

用法: sodium_crypto_core_ristretto255_scalar_sub(string $a, string $b): string

参数:

  • $a: 表示第一个Ristretto255标量的字符串表示形式。
  • $b: 表示第二个Ristretto255标量的字符串表示形式。

返回值: 该函数返回一个字符串,表示两个标量的差值。

示例:

$a = sodium_crypto_core_ristretto255_scalar_random(); // 生成一个随机的Ristretto255标量
$b = sodium_crypto_core_ristretto255_scalar_random(); // 生成另一个随机的Ristretto255标量

$sub = sodium_crypto_core_ristretto255_scalar_sub($a, $b);
echo bin2hex($sub); // 输出两个标量的差值的十六进制表示形式

注意事项:

  • 输入的标量必须是Ristretto255标量,并且以字符串的形式表示。
  • 输出的差值也是以字符串的形式表示。
  • 该函数需要PHP安装libsodium扩展才能正常工作。
评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流